├── .github └── workflows │ ├── ci.yaml │ ├── notebooks.yaml │ └── pypi-publish.yaml ├── .gitignore ├── .pre-commit-config.yaml ├── .readthedocs.yaml ├── LICENSE ├── README.md ├── docs ├── Makefile ├── make.bat ├── requirements-sphinx-build.txt └── source │ ├── conf.py │ ├── docs_api │ ├── probfindiff.rst │ └── probfindiff │ │ ├── collocation.rst │ │ ├── stencil.rst │ │ ├── utils.rst │ │ └── utils │ │ ├── autodiff.rst │ │ ├── kernel.rst │ │ └── kernel_zoo.rst │ ├── docs_dev │ ├── contribution_guide.md │ └── examples.md │ ├── getting_started │ ├── installation.md │ └── quickstart.ipynb │ ├── index.rst │ └── notebooks │ ├── batched_evaluations.ipynb │ ├── calibration.ipynb │ ├── custom_grid.ipynb │ ├── kernel_models.ipynb │ ├── multivariate_derivatives.ipynb │ ├── noisy_schemes.ipynb │ └── partial_derivatives.ipynb ├── pyproject.toml ├── setup.cfg ├── setup.py ├── src └── probfindiff │ ├── __init__.py │ ├── _toplevel_api.py │ ├── backend │ ├── __init__.py │ └── typing.py │ ├── collocation.py │ ├── defaults.py │ ├── stencil.py │ └── utils │ ├── __init__.py │ ├── autodiff.py │ ├── kernel.py │ └── kernel_zoo.py ├── tests ├── __init__.py ├── test_collocation.py ├── test_stencil.py ├── test_toplevel_api.py └── test_utils │ ├── __init__.py │ ├── test_autodiff.py │ └── test_kernel.py └── tox.ini /.github/workflows/ci.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/.github/workflows/ci.yaml -------------------------------------------------------------------------------- /.github/workflows/notebooks.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/.github/workflows/notebooks.yaml -------------------------------------------------------------------------------- /.github/workflows/pypi-publish.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/.github/workflows/pypi-publish.yaml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/.gitignore -------------------------------------------------------------------------------- /.pre-commit-config.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/.pre-commit-config.yaml -------------------------------------------------------------------------------- /.readthedocs.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/.readthedocs.yaml -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/README.md -------------------------------------------------------------------------------- /docs/Makefile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/Makefile -------------------------------------------------------------------------------- /docs/make.bat: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/make.bat -------------------------------------------------------------------------------- /docs/requirements-sphinx-build.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/requirements-sphinx-build.txt -------------------------------------------------------------------------------- /docs/source/conf.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/conf.py -------------------------------------------------------------------------------- /docs/source/docs_api/probfindiff.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/docs_api/probfindiff.rst -------------------------------------------------------------------------------- /docs/source/docs_api/probfindiff/collocation.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/docs_api/probfindiff/collocation.rst -------------------------------------------------------------------------------- /docs/source/docs_api/probfindiff/stencil.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/docs_api/probfindiff/stencil.rst -------------------------------------------------------------------------------- /docs/source/docs_api/probfindiff/utils.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/docs_api/probfindiff/utils.rst -------------------------------------------------------------------------------- /docs/source/docs_api/probfindiff/utils/autodiff.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/docs_api/probfindiff/utils/autodiff.rst -------------------------------------------------------------------------------- /docs/source/docs_api/probfindiff/utils/kernel.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/docs_api/probfindiff/utils/kernel.rst -------------------------------------------------------------------------------- /docs/source/docs_api/probfindiff/utils/kernel_zoo.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/docs_api/probfindiff/utils/kernel_zoo.rst -------------------------------------------------------------------------------- /docs/source/docs_dev/contribution_guide.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/docs_dev/contribution_guide.md -------------------------------------------------------------------------------- /docs/source/docs_dev/examples.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/docs_dev/examples.md -------------------------------------------------------------------------------- /docs/source/getting_started/installation.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/getting_started/installation.md -------------------------------------------------------------------------------- /docs/source/getting_started/quickstart.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/getting_started/quickstart.ipynb -------------------------------------------------------------------------------- /docs/source/index.rst: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/index.rst -------------------------------------------------------------------------------- /docs/source/notebooks/batched_evaluations.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/notebooks/batched_evaluations.ipynb -------------------------------------------------------------------------------- /docs/source/notebooks/calibration.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/notebooks/calibration.ipynb -------------------------------------------------------------------------------- /docs/source/notebooks/custom_grid.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/notebooks/custom_grid.ipynb -------------------------------------------------------------------------------- /docs/source/notebooks/kernel_models.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/notebooks/kernel_models.ipynb -------------------------------------------------------------------------------- /docs/source/notebooks/multivariate_derivatives.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/notebooks/multivariate_derivatives.ipynb -------------------------------------------------------------------------------- /docs/source/notebooks/noisy_schemes.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/notebooks/noisy_schemes.ipynb -------------------------------------------------------------------------------- /docs/source/notebooks/partial_derivatives.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/docs/source/notebooks/partial_derivatives.ipynb -------------------------------------------------------------------------------- /pyproject.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/pyproject.toml -------------------------------------------------------------------------------- /setup.cfg: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/setup.cfg -------------------------------------------------------------------------------- /setup.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/setup.py -------------------------------------------------------------------------------- /src/probfindiff/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/src/probfindiff/__init__.py -------------------------------------------------------------------------------- /src/probfindiff/_toplevel_api.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/src/probfindiff/_toplevel_api.py -------------------------------------------------------------------------------- /src/probfindiff/backend/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/src/probfindiff/backend/typing.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/src/probfindiff/backend/typing.py -------------------------------------------------------------------------------- /src/probfindiff/collocation.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/src/probfindiff/collocation.py -------------------------------------------------------------------------------- /src/probfindiff/defaults.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/src/probfindiff/defaults.py -------------------------------------------------------------------------------- /src/probfindiff/stencil.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/src/probfindiff/stencil.py -------------------------------------------------------------------------------- /src/probfindiff/utils/__init__.py: -------------------------------------------------------------------------------- 1 | """Utility functions and modules.""" 2 | -------------------------------------------------------------------------------- /src/probfindiff/utils/autodiff.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/src/probfindiff/utils/autodiff.py -------------------------------------------------------------------------------- /src/probfindiff/utils/kernel.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/src/probfindiff/utils/kernel.py -------------------------------------------------------------------------------- /src/probfindiff/utils/kernel_zoo.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/src/probfindiff/utils/kernel_zoo.py -------------------------------------------------------------------------------- /tests/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/tests/test_collocation.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/tests/test_collocation.py -------------------------------------------------------------------------------- /tests/test_stencil.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/tests/test_stencil.py -------------------------------------------------------------------------------- /tests/test_toplevel_api.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/tests/test_toplevel_api.py -------------------------------------------------------------------------------- /tests/test_utils/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/tests/test_utils/test_autodiff.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/tests/test_utils/test_autodiff.py -------------------------------------------------------------------------------- /tests/test_utils/test_kernel.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/tests/test_utils/test_kernel.py -------------------------------------------------------------------------------- /tox.ini: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/pnkraemer/probfindiff/HEAD/tox.ini --------------------------------------------------------------------------------